alert怎么修改弹窗样式
的有关信息介绍如下:alert是HTML DOM 中用到了一种脚本语言,其主要用法就是在你自己定义了一定的函数以后,通过执行相应的操作,所弹出对话框的语言。并且alert对话框通常用于一些对用户的提示信息。
alert的样式是由浏览器决定的,我们无法更改alert的样式。
不过我们可以使用重写alert的方式来,改变alert的样式。
用下面这一行代码替代alert方法:
window.alert = function() {};
在function(){} 里创建一个div作为alert出来的内容。如下:
window.alert = function(txt){
var div = document.createElement("DIV");
}
给这个alert出来的DIV设置样式,颜色、宽、高、对齐、位置等等:
window.alert = function(txt){
var div = document.createElement("DIV");
shield.style.position = "absolute";
shield.style.background = "#333";
shield.style.textAlign = "center";
shield.style.zIndex = "9999999";
}
设置完成之后,在页面中调用alert,效果如下: